Nuclear Medicine Technologist
Performs diagnostic imaging in Nuclear Medicine areas as directed by providers and or radiologist, providing timely and quality service to patient. Follows Department policies for using radioactive materials to maintain a safe, efficient and economical environment. Interacts with patients to welcome, explain and respond to questions and concerns during and following the procedure.
